- In the summer of 1968, Christian mystic Thomas Merton undertook a pilgrimage to the American West. Fifty years later, filmmaker Jeremy Seifert and writer Fred Bahnson set out to follow Merton’s path, retracing the monk’s journey across the landscape. Amid stunning backdrops of ocean, redwood, and canyon, the film features the faces and voices of people Merton encountered.
This film premiered in the fourth issue of Emergence Magazine on "Faith" with an accompanying essay by Fred Bahnson. Read or listen to the essay here: www.emergencema...
